About Assisted LivingAssisted living facilities offer housing and care for active seniors who may need support with activities of daily living, like bathing, dressing, and medication management.Complete guide to assisted livingBest of 2026 Assisted Living Winners
About Memory CareMemory care facilities provide housing, care, and therapies for seniors who have Alzheimer’s disease or other forms of dementia in an environment designed to reduce confusion and prevent wandering. Complete guide to memory careBest of 2026 Memory Care Winners
About Independent LivingIndependent living facilities offer convenient, hassle-free living in a social environment for seniors who are active, healthy, and able to live on their own.Complete guide to independent livingBest of 2026 Independent Living Winners
About Senior LivingSenior living is a term used to describe various housing and care options for older adults from maintenance-free, 55+ facilities for active seniors, to secure, fully staffed facilities for seniors with Alzheimer's or dementia. Memory care in Bedford offers 24-hour care and supervision, trained staff, and specialized activities to accommodate the needs of seniors with Alzheimer’s or dementia. These communities typically offer advanced security features and engaging activities to help ensure residents’ well-being. The cost of memory care in Bedford is about $5,134 per month. Cost of memory care in Bedford, TX

The average cost of senior living in Bedford is $5,134 per month. Cheaper nearby regions include Kennedale, TX with an average of $4,943 per month.

State regulations for memory care in Bedford

Safety is a primary concern when seniors and their families look for memory care. Each state has its own laws and inspection processes to help ensure seniors reside in a safe environment and receive quality care. Learning about Texas memory care regulations will help you understand how memory care communities in Bedford protect seniors.
